Clio and NetDocuments Announce Integration

Clio and NetDocuments Partner to Offer Secure Cloud-based Document Management and Collaboration for Small and Mid-Sized Law Firms

Themis Solutions Inc., creator of cloud-based practice management platform Clio, is pleased to announce an integration with NetDocuments, streamlining the creation and sharing of documents among staff, co-counsel and clients.

Small and mid-sized law firms get the benefits of practice management through Clio, managing their practices from intake to invoicing, and the power of NetDocuments for storing, organizing and searching documents.

Law firms can take full advantage of NetDocuments directly with Clio to:

  • Upload documents to NetDocuments and associate them with Matters in Clio;
  • Use their favorite programs to create, open and save documents directly to NetDocuments / Clio from within Word, Excel, PowerPoint and Outlook;
  • Powerful full-text searching of documents;
  • Optional on-premise document backup with NetDocument’s Local Document Service

The NetDocuments integration is being released initially as a beta with a general availability release anticipated in May 2013. Clio users interested in participating in the beta may request access via [email protected].
